If you or a friend thinks science is boring, then you or your friend needs to come to the Exploratorium. There are exhibits that demonstrate or manipulate how the five senses interpret the world. Why can you lie down on a sheet of nails, but one nail alone will impale you? How does a baseball curve? These questions can be explained by the many docents waiting to answer your questions. There is a cafeteria in case you didn't bring your own lunch. There is a gift shop for momentos too. My favorite is the Tactile Dome. You get to experience what a blind person goes through each day. Advance reservations are needed. The only drawback is that it gets crowded when many teachers schedule field trips on the same day.
